Nutrient Comparison: Boiled Dock VS Stewed Canned Tomatoes per 14 oz
Compare the macro and micronutrient content in 14 oz of Boiled Dock versus 14 oz of Stewed Canned Tomatoes to make informed dietary choices. Explore their nutritional differences and benefits.
Lets compare vitamin content per 14 ounces of Boiled Dock vs Stewed Canned Tomatoes:
- 14 ounces of Boiled Dock have 19.3 times more Vitamin A, 2.5 times more Vitamin B2, 5.9 times more Vitamin B6, 1.6 times more Vitamin B9 and 3.3 times more Vitamin C than Stewed Canned Tomatoes.
- While 14 oz of Stewed Canned Ripe Red Tomatoes contain 1.4 times more Vitamin B1, 1.7 times more Vitamin B3 and 3.2 times more Vitamin B5 than Boiled and Drained Dock.
- 14 ounces of Boiled Dock have insufficient amounts of Vitamin B5
- 14 ounces of Stewed Canned Tomatoes have insufficient amounts of Vitamin A, Vitamin B6 and Vitamin B9
- Both Boiled and Drained Dock as well as Stewed Canned Ripe Red Tomatoes have insufficient amounts of Vitamin B12 and Vitamin D in 14 ounces.
Comparing minerals per 14 ounces for Boiled Dock vs Stewed Canned Tomatoes:
- 14 ounces of Boiled Dock have 1.6 times more Iron, 7.4 times more Magnesium, 5.1 times more Manganese, 2.6 times more Phosphorus and 1.6 times more Potassium than Stewed Canned Tomatoes.
- While 14 oz of Stewed Canned Ripe Red Tomatoes contain 73.7 times more Sodium than Boiled and Drained Dock.
- Both Boiled Dock and Stewed Canned Tomatoes contain similar levels of Calcium, Copper and Water per 14 ounces.
- Both Boiled and Drained Dock as well as Stewed Canned Ripe Red Tomatoes lack sufficient amounts of Selenium and Zinc in 14 ounces.
Comparison of macro-nutrients per 14 ounces:
- 14 ounces of Boiled Dock have 2.6 times more Fiber and 2 times more Protein than Stewed Canned Tomatoes.
- While 14 oz of Stewed Canned Ripe Red Tomatoes contain 2.1 times more Carbohydrate than Boiled and Drained Dock.
- 14 ounces of Stewed Canned Tomatoes provide inadequate amounts of Protein
- Both Boiled and Drained Dock as well as Stewed Canned Ripe Red Tomatoes provide inadequate amounts of Energy in 14 ounces.
